Bandai Namco released a new trailer for Digimon Story Cyber Sleuth: Complete Edition that bundles Digimon Story Cyber Sleuth and Digimon Story Cyber Sleuth: Hacker’s Memory for Nintendo Switch and PC.
Today, Bandai Namco announced that Digimon Story Cyber Sleuth and Digimon Story Cyber Sleuth: Hacker’s Memory are being ported to the Nintendo Switch and PC as a collection, releasing October 18, 2019.

Digimon Story: Cyber Sleuth Hacker’s Memory recently held a Twitter retweet campaign in order to unlock four new Digimon, which would be added in future free DLC, and the campaign was a success, garnering over 10,000 retweets in total.
Bandai Namco launched a retweet campaign with the goal to hit 2018 retweets by January 5 to add four new Digimon for Digimon Story: Cyber Sleuth Hacker’s Memory.
